Ten lepers were cleansed, one returned to give thanks.
There’s something about being sick, either chronically or terminally, that robs a person of an identity separate from that illness. In a world where we often mistake cures for healing, this story forced us to explore what makes the one who returned well in a way the other nine somehow missed.
